What I meant was that sometimes in a typical butt plate (with a threaded hole) the plate
is a little out of alignment which allow the plate to be tightned down but the butt still
wobbles because because the center pin is not in the groove.

As far as the glue goes, sometimes there is a tiny split in the wood below the felt lined
hole the centerpin pivots in which allows a little wobble in the hammer butt assembly.

> So, you are saying then that you have the type of hammer butt where the brass plate is
> attached directly to the butt with a wood screw? If so, I have found that cleaning and
> filing the surface of the hammer butt where the butt plate attaches helps sometimes.
> The butt and butt plate have to mate precisely. But if the screw hole is stripped no
> amount of tightening will do it. And if that part is ok but the flange bushing is worn
> slightly you will either have to re-pin or replace the flange. (I guess that part is
> obvious)  ;-)

> > > James Dally wrote:
> > >
> > > > I installed new butts and hammers on a Kroehler upright.  I have checked
> > > > the brass rail and the brass butts where the screw goes in.  This is the
> > > > type where the screw goes through the rail and then the brass butt receives
> > > > the threaded screw.  The butts have been replaced where hammers have
> > > > loosened but the problem continues.  When it seems I have solved the
> > > > problem, another hammer loosens.  As near as I can tell the rail is not
> > > > cracked.  If anyone has had experience with this problem I will certainly
> > > > appreciate advice.  Jim Dally
